Rather than using heavy cream and going through the egg yolk tempering process, I used my spirit fruit-veggie – the avocado! It may sound strange, but avocado makes for a creamy, dreamy, thick mousse. I promise you can’t taste it past the chocolate!
Food with benefits…let’s talk about this situation.
This recipe includes only 4 super simple ingredients (5 if you count salt): avocados, honey, non-dairy milk, and raw cacao powder). Avocados are full of omega 3 and omega 6 fatty acids, which are great for your brain, skin, and digestive system. The healthy fat in avocados boosts your metabolism and helps digest the essential vitamins and minerals in your food.

Using raw honey to sweeten the mousse gives it a natural antibiotic and antiviral quality. Additionally, raw cacao powder is full of minerals and antioxidants. Combining these superfoods results in a dessert that spans beyond the reaches of delicious – it is also quite healthy for you!

Another MEGA bonus: all we do to prepare this recipe is throw everything in a food processor (or blender) and process until smooth!

Change ups and substitutions: if you want to go the extra mile, add ¼ teaspoon pure vanilla extract and/or ¼ teaspoon ground cinnamon. Sure, it adds a teeeeentsy smidge of extra work, but it’s worth it! The vanilla and cinnamon flavors round it out and give a warm flavor to the dessert. You can also add a little bourbon if you’re looking for a booze-infused dessert. Want to substitute the raw cacao powder for unsweetened cocoa powder? No problem! Want to add a small cooked beet for some extra Vitamins and antioxidants? Much encouraged! You can also make this recipe vegan by swapping the honey out for pure maple syrup.
